This is an ancient Roman Silver Denarius, of Emperor Antoninus Pius, minted at Rome between 155 - 156 AD 

Obverse:  ANTONINVS AVG PIVS PP IMP II, "Antoninus Pius, emperor (Augustus) father of the nation, supreme commander (Imperator) for the second time" laureate head right

Reverse:  TR POT XIX COS IIII, "Holder of tribunician power for the 19th time, consul for the fourth time" Annona standing facing, head to left, holding grain ears and modius set on prow.
